I just looked at Phillipa's list.  It's a good beginning, but is
incomplete. I need a list that, in addition to giving a definition, tells
me where the word was used and cites examples of use.
For example:
Mountance, mountenaunce = Amount, weight
- Harl. 270, #44 Meselade - "...[th]e mountance of a mosselle of Brede..."
- LCC, For to make momene - "...Take powder [th]o mountenaunce of a pownde..."
Can we make this a group project, with someone proposing a few words per
week, & the rest of us finding citations & definitions for it?  (IMO, it
beats talking about kittens.)
